Walther von Krenner

Walther is a long time martial artist, starting his training in 1957, who has also studied Sho-do and Sumi-e. His martial arts background includes training with Uyeshiba Morihei and with his son Uyeshiba Kishomaru as well as Tohei Koichi. His love for the military arts is paralleled by his artistic appreciation of Japanese brush painting and calligraphy. His works have been exhibited and are in private collections in Japan, Europe, and the United States. This is art done by a warrior and in varying styles reflects the sometimes powerful, sometimes sensitive nature of a warrior.
